“Next level” Lucid Air EV unveiled

“Next level” Lucid Air EV unveiled

Posted on September 10, 2020August 27, 2023 By Jarvis

Battery-electric sedan launches with $230K Dream Edition

As bushfire smoke cloaked San Francisco, Silicon Valley start-up Lucid Motors has launched the emissions-free battery-electric Lucid Air sedan.

Long-anticipated and much-hyped, the Lucid Air is intended “to take the electric car to the next level”, according to Lucid Motors chief executive officer and chief technical officer Peter Rawlinson.

“With the Lucid Air, we have created a halo car for the entire industry, one which shows the advancements that are possible by pushing the boundaries of EV technology and performance to new levels,” he said.
